Our Faculty's Department of Physiotherapy and Rehabilitation includes the Electrophysical Agents Laboratory, which is a well-equipped educational environment that allows students to recognize electrotherapy devices used in physiotherapy and rehabilitation and to learn treatment methods with these devices practically. This laboratory is equipped with modern devices to teach the use of technologies such as electrical stimulation, ultrasound, laser, shortwave diathermy, and TENS, which are widely used in physiotherapy.
In the laboratory, practical training is also provided with state-of-the-art devices such as hot-cold applications used in physiotherapy and rehabilitation, agents containing infrared and ultraviolet light, hydrotherapy applications, and wearable pressure corsets aimed at increasing circulation and reducing pain.
Students experience the treatment protocols and clinical applications of electrophysical agents, learning the effects of these techniques on musculoskeletal disorders, pain management, wound healing, and neurological disorders. Detailed training is provided on the correct use of each device in the laboratory, allowing students to transform their theoretical knowledge into practice.
Additionally, the laboratory offers an environment that enables research projects and clinical studies. In this way, students can examine the innovative applications and therapeutic effects of electrophysical agents in the field of physiotherapy from a scientific perspective. The Electrophysical Agents Laboratory plays an important role in providing students with professional competence as an integral part of physiotherapy education.
